Women's Golf Rounds Out Fall Season With Fourth Place Finish

SILVER LAKE, Ohio – The Bowling Green women's golf program concluded the fall season with a fourth place finish at the Silver Lake Shootout. The Falcons combined for a team score of 645, +69 at the University of Akron-hosted event.
Bowling Green carded a team score of 321 in the first round this morning, followed by a 324 in the afternoon to complete the 36-hole tournament.
"It's disappointing we weren't able to improve in the second round," Bowling Green women's golf head coach Stephanie Young said. "Overall, we walk away with a great opportunity to preview the MAC Championship course and will strive to improve over the break and be ready for competition in February."
Leading the Falcons was senior Mikayla Baer, who topped the Bowling Green leaderboard in her third event of the season with an 11th place finish overall. The Elmore, Ohio native marked a round of 80 this morning, then shaved off two strokes for a second round score of 78. Baer accomplished the total score of 155, +14 by tallying a team-leading two birdies and 22 pars, in addition to earning a 4.45 stroke average on par four scoring, and a 5.13 average on par five scoring.
Leading the Falcons with a 3.13 stroke average and +1 mark on par three scoring was freshman Brooke Nolte. A native of Melissa, Texas, Nolte finished in a tie for 13th overall by carding rounds of 78 and 84, for a tournament total of 162, +18. Nolte also tallied two birdies and 19 pars on the day. With the score, Nolte finished in the top-two spots on the Falcons leaderboard in all five events of the fall season.
Taking 15th place at the Silver Lake Shootout was sophomore Erin Fahey. The Austin, Texas native made a dramatic improvement from the first to second rounds, by cutting five strokes from her score for a total of 163, +19. Fahey marked scores of 84 and 79 in the first and second rounds, respectively, with two birdies and 19 pars. Fahey also averaged a 3.25 mark on par three scoring, 4.65 on par four scoring, and a 5.50 stroke average on the Silver Lake Country Club's four par-five holes.
Trailing Fahey by just two strokes and finishing in a tie for 16th overall was senior Fran Rodriguez. A native of Flower Mound, Texas, Rodriguez carded a team-leading -1 mark and 4.88 stroke average on par five scoring at the Silver Lake Shootout, in addition to 18 pars on the day. Rodriguez also averaged 3.38 strokes and a +3 score on par three scoring over the course of the 36-hole event.
With a total score of 170, +26, freshman Jessica Madry rounded out the Falcons team lineup. The Houston, Texas native finished in a tie for 24th overall after carding rounds of 81 and 89 in the tournament. In the process of adding two birdies to her scorecard, Madry also averaged 3.38 strokes and a +3 mark on par three scoring in her fourth event of the fall season.
Competing individually for the Falcons was sophomore Julia Durkin. In her second event of the season, Durkin finished in a tie for 22nd place and improved on her first round score of 86, to card an 83 in the second round for a final score of 169, +25. Durkin averaged 3.25 strokes across the Silver Lake Country Club's four par-three holes, and 4.70 strokes on the course's 10 par-four holes. The native of Miramar, Fla. also tallied two birdies in addition to 17 pars on the day.
The Bowling Green women's golf program will resume competition on Feb. 13 and Feb. 14 at the Women's Mid-American Match Play Challenge in Lakewood Ranch, Fla.
